vers_us Posted April 25, 2017 Report Share Posted April 25, 2017 (edited) HiI am stuck with initial setup on my ER34. Engine start and run well on reach AFR (10:1) but try to stall if TP inreased (TP delta is aprox 4%, at this moment AFR is about 22:1). Specs:* RB25DET NEO (with stock internals and sensors)* FFP with 80mm throtle* Holset HX35 turbo* Aeromotive FPR* Innovate LC2 * Siemens DEKA 630cc injectors The problem is on injectors setup. I try to use traditional and modeled fuel equation with this injectors but have no result. Almost all params in Fuels Setup doesn't affect AFR on idle. Only MinEffectivePulseWidth and InjDeadTime affect AFR. What i'am doing wrong in my setup?Thank you in advice.P.S. attached pclr with traditional fuel equation. vers_us Posted May 18, 2017 Author Report Share Posted May 18, 2017 Thanks for reply Adam!Still have issue with ECU setup. I've check fuel pressure and its normal (about 2.4 Bar on idle and 3 Bar if engine stops, also i try to accelerate and it's goes up and down with MAP). As you can see on image if i try to rev engine AFR goes to 22:1. Same thing happend when i switch gear up. No matter acceleration enrichment is ON or OFF.I will be grateful for any help. Adamw Posted May 19, 2017 Report Share Posted May 19, 2017 (edited) You have something odd going on here? The ECU seems to be commanding approximately correct pulsewidths yet your Lambda goes to the sky.It is really odd the in the plot below, you snap the throttle shut quite quickly yet MAP is very slow to return back to vacuum. Usually MAP and TP follow very similar trends. To me this suggests there is possibly something mechanical wrong - maybe a manifold leak or something? Also the fact that you have a VE of 80% at idle suggests something like injector flow rate is not as expected.
